Machine Damage Risk:
Even if a row will not be used, a meter must be installed.
Operating the drill with a meter removed will result in
machine damage. The meter housing is required to keep the
drive plate aligned. With no meter present, the drive chain
will strike drill parts.

Refer to Figure 58
11. Insert the inner sliding seed tube into the upper

outer tube. If the tube is chamfered on only one end,
insert the chamfered end up.

12. Move the screw clamp from the previous meter to

the grommet of the meter just installed.

13. Install the new meter. Insert the top (hooked) tab

first, then the bottom, in the slots of the opener
mount channel.

Refer to Figure 55
14. Swing the drive plate into the meter shaft and

engage the upper meter latch. Make sure the
tapered line-up pins near the drive sprocket engage
completely in line-up holes.

Note: Always engage the upper latch first.

Refer to Figure 56
15. Engage the lower meter latch.

16. Slide the inner seed tube into the grommet until it

stops against the ridge inside the grommet.

17. Position the screw clamp close to the top of the

grommet and tighten the screw.
